The AM1D-1205SH60-NZ is a 1W isolated DC-DC converter module from the Aimtec AM1D-NZ series. It accepts a nominal 12V input (10.8V to 13.2V range) and provides a regulated 5V output at up to 200mA. The converter features 6000VDC input-to-output isolation, making it suitable for applications requiring high galvanic isolation.
Key electrical specifications include a typical efficiency of 78% at full load, ripple and noise of 75 mVp-p, line regulation of ±1.2%, and load regulation of 10%. The operating temperature range is -40°C to +105°C with derating, and the maximum case temperature is 125°C. The module is RoHS3 compliant.
The AM1D-1205SH60-NZ is packaged in a through-hole 7-SIP module with 4 leads, measuring 19.5mm x 9.8mm x 12.5mm. It is designed for commercial ITE (Information Technology Equipment) applications. Per the manufacturer datasheet, this model is marked for discontinuation (EOL) and is not recommended for new designs; it is intended for legacy applications.
